Propagation Delay
The time it takes for a signal to travel from one point to another in a network, affecting the overall communication speed.
Radio
A technology that uses radio waves to transmit information, such as sound, by modulating properties of electromagnetic energy waves transmitted through space.
Satellite
A man-made object that is launched to circle around the earth or another celestial body, used for gathering data or for communication purposes.
Microwave
An electromagnetic wave with a wavelength shorter than that of a normal radio wave but longer than those of infrared radiation, commonly used in microwave ovens to heat food.
